This night-time photograph captures an illuminated, curved pedestrian bridge in Daejeon, South Korea. The image is taken from a low angle, looking upwards and along the length of the bridge, creating a sense of depth and emphasizing its architectural form. The main subject is the bridge's structure, composed of light-colored, possibly concrete or painted metal, elements that curve gracefully. The pathway, visible on the right side, is a textured, brownish-yellow surface, brightly lit by numerous streetlights. Along the bridge's edge, there are white metal railings featuring decorative patterns. Some sections have horizontal bars, while others showcase an intricate, repeated design resembling circular or leaf-like motifs in green, set within a white framework. Modern streetlights with distinctive curved brackets and circular light fixtures line the bridge, casting a warm yellow-orange glow that dominates the scene. The closest streetlight creates a prominent lens flare. On the far right, a textured wall runs parallel to the pathway, likely part of an embankment or adjacent infrastructure. The sky is dark and appears grainy, indicative of low-light photography, with distant urban lights faintly visible in the background. A faint purple light source can be seen in the upper right. The absence of people suggests a quiet moment on the bridge. No discernible text is visible within the frame. The overall impression is one of a well-lit, architecturally interesting urban pathway under the night sky.
